Antti Laitinen at Rauma Art Museum

Works by Antti Laitinen are on view at Rauma Art Museum as part of joint exhibition Sula || Molten, with Hanna Saarikoski. The exhibition brings together two artists around a common theme: ice as a material, a disappearing natural resource and a sensual memory.

The exhibition asks what will happen if there is no ice in the future? How will the great generation gap emerge as the everyday and sensual world is transformed by climate change? These are questions that deeply affect our identity in the north. Antti Laitinen and Hanna Saarikoski made their first joint work in 2024 for the Art II Biennial. The exhibition at Rauma Art Museum continues the collaboration of the Somero-based artist couple with new artworks. The exhibition mainly consists of independent works by both artists.

Sula || Molten runs until 18 May 2025.
